Quick answer

TDEE is your BMR multiplied by an activity factor ranging from 1.2 (sedentary) to 1.9 (extremely active).

TDEE = BMR x activity factor

How to use the TDEE Activity Multiplier Calculator

  1. 1Enter sex, weight, height and age to compute BMR by Mifflin-St Jeor.
  2. 2Choose the activity level that best matches your typical week, not your best day.
  3. 3Reassess every few weeks as weight changes since TDEE shifts with body size.

Frequently asked questions

Which activity level should I pick?

Most desk workers who exercise 3-4x/week fall in 'moderately active'.

Is this exact?

No — TDEE estimates carry roughly ±10% error; use trends in your actual weight to calibrate.
